Leaking gas tank- drip drip
My '81 euro is leaking fuel. The leak is at the bottom of the tank where a hose comes out. When the car is not running I can see a drop of gas just hangning there. When car is running it drips rather fast. I checked and the filler hose and that's not it. I think it must be the fuel pump line. Does this hose crack and leak or could it be a seal where it meets the tank? Any advice on repair is very much appreciated.

Flormat,
Most properly a bad hose.
All the hose connection are at the topside of the tank
If that's only when totally full, that is the vent hose, but as you describe it sound like it is the pressure or return line.
Try to recognise from where the drips comes, first remove the cover for the pump and filter maybe there, if not, remove your tank, and that will be relative easy to find the failure.

Yeah- there is a panel that detaches from the fuel tank that allows you to see the pump and filter.
It almost looks like a woman's bra- two straps that go up the tank and end with bolts, and then a section that actually covers the "goodies"-
[Y'all don't go anywhere with this...I'm trying to be serious for a change...]
Un-bolt this and remove. CAREFULLY, using two wrenches, tighten the all the connections. I had a constant drip for a while until I did this...
